| Provides job seekers with assistance at three area job centers. Each of the three centers provides skills assessment, job search assistance, information about training programs and financial aid for education, job postings and referrals to employers, information on child care and transportation, and a variety of helpful workshops offered weekly. Each center also provides computers (with internet access), printers, fax, telephone, and copiers for job search activities. |
